There’s something special about **Fox & Goose Public House**. It’s a true Sacramento staple, full of history and memories for so many of us — myself included. And because of that, this review comes with a little bit of love… and a little bit of tough honesty. If I were rating purely on nostalgia and all the amazing breakfasts I’ve had here over the years, this would be an easy five stars. This visit, though, felt more like a solid four. The food was fine — not bad at all — just not as memorable as it used to be. Portions seemed noticeably smaller than I remember, and some of the flavor felt a bit lackluster compared to the magic Fox & Goose used to deliver. We ordered the quiche of the day. It was pretty good, nicely cooked, but it didn’t have that “wow” factor or bold personality that makes you think about it later. I had the Athena omelette, and unfortunately, it didn’t quite shine. It mostly tasted like tomatoes, and I barely saw or tasted the feta. It just didn’t have much presence or depth — not bad, just not memorable. Now let’s talk about the reason we really came: the olallieberry scones with Devonshire cream. These used to be legendary. There was always that excitement of ordering them — the only question was how many more we could squeeze in before leaving. This time, they were still good… but smaller, and missing that magic touch I remember. And the $2 extra charge for the Devonshire cream felt a little unnecessary. It just didn’t hit the same way. On the bright side, the coffee was great (as always), and the sides that came with the plates were good too. Service and atmosphere still carry that cozy, classic feel. I may sound harsh, and that’s honestly not my intention. I love this place. I’ve had so many great memories here over the years, which is why I think I felt the difference so strongly this time. It just felt more like a typical diner visit instead of the iconic Sacramento experience I’ve always associated with Fox & Goose. That said — the food was not terrible at all. It’s still a solid spot for breakfast, and people should absolutely go try it and enjoy it. I’m giving four stars because it still deserves support and customers. I just hope it finds that magic again, because longtime fans know how special it can truly be.

I came here for Saturday breakfast. It was quite a long wait. We were told 20 minutes, but it took more than a half hour. I wanted to try something different, so I ordered the New Yorker omelette which had smoked salmon, cream cheese, and chives along with potatoes and a crumpet. I enjoyed it, although I felt like the smoked salmon was a little too overpowering in the flavor, so I'd probably get something else if I came here again. I enjoyed the ambiance; it used to be an old paint factory, but it was remodeled very nicely. Our table wobbled a lot and spilled our coffee and drinks quite a bit. That could be a quick fix if the management gives it some attention. Overall, it was a pleasant experience.

Fox & Goose is a cozy and welcoming English pub that serves a real hearty breakfast. The place feels warm and old-fashioned with wood tables, big windows, and a relaxed atmosphere that makes you want to take your time. The food was excellent and felt authentic. The traditional English breakfast came with eggs, bacon, sausage, baked beans, and toast. Everything tasted fresh and well-cooked. The potatoes and scones were also really good, simple and comforting. Service was friendly and easygoing, and the whole experience was very enjoyable. It’s a great spot for a proper English breakfast and a pleasant way to start the day.
